Feasibility study of new applications at the high-temperature gas-cooled reactor

Ho, H. Q.   ; Honda, Yuki*; Hamamoto, Shimpei  ; Ishii, Toshiaki ; Takada, Shoji; Fujimoto, Nozomu*; Ishitsuka, Etsuo   

Besides the electricity generation and hydrogen production, HTGRs have many advantages for thermal neutron irradiation applications such as stable operation in longterm, large space available for irradiation target, and high thermal neutron economy. This study summarized the feasibility of new irradiation applications at the HTGRs including neutron transmutation doping silicon and I-125 productions. The HTTR located in Japan was used as a reference HTGR in this study. Calculation results show that HTTR could irradiate about 40 tons of doped Si particles per year for fabrication of spherical silicon solar cell. Besides, the HTTR could also produce about 1.8x105 GBq in a year of I-125, comparing to 3.0x103 GBq of total I-125 supplied in Japan in 2016.
